eh heres a guide install WAMP;
then (if windows 7) right click icon and click props then click
compatibility then click run as admin

then open your main drive (or where ever you installed it normaly c:\)
right click on WAMP can click off read only.

then run wamp and click on the icon in the right side tray
move ya mouse over sql then click install service

then move over to php then php ext and make sure these are clicked
php_mysql
php_mysqli
php_pdo_mysql
php_pdo_sqli

SQLi SETUP!
